如何安裝和部署Mysql(Percona-Server)
Mysql是一個流行的關系型數據庫管理系統(tǒng)。Percona-Server是基于Mysql的一個分支,提供了更好的性能和可靠性。在本文中,我們將討論如何安裝和部署Percona-Server。1、下載P
Mysql是一個流行的關系型數據庫管理系統(tǒng)。Percona-Server是基于Mysql的一個分支,提供了更好的性能和可靠性。在本文中,我們將討論如何安裝和部署Percona-Server。
1、下載Percona-Server
首先,我們需要從Percona官網下載Percona-Server的壓縮包。由于地址不方便公開,在無法找到的情況下可以留言私聊獲取。
2、上傳至CentOS
下載完成后,我們需要將壓縮包上傳至CentOS服務器上??梢允褂胹cp命令或者其他方式進行上傳。
3、安裝cmake
在安裝Percona-Server之前,我們還需要安裝cmake??梢酝ㄟ^以下命令進行安裝:
sudo yum -y install cmake
4、創(chuàng)建mysql-percona目錄
在/usr/local/src/目錄下創(chuàng)建mysql-percona目錄:
sudo mkdir mysql-percona
5、進入mysql-percona目錄
使用cd命令進入mysql-percona目錄:
cd mysql-percona
6、拷貝Percona-Server-5.6.31-77.0-r5c1061c-el6-x86_64-bundle.tar到mysql-percona
使用sudo cp命令將下載的Percona-Server壓縮包拷貝到mysql-percona目錄下:
sudo cp /home/sk/app/Percona-Server-5.6.31-77.0-r5c1061c-el6-x86_64-bundle.tar ./
7、解壓Percona-Server
在mysql-percona目錄下,使用以下命令解壓Percona-Server:
sudo tar -xvf Percona-Server-5.6.31-77.0-r5c1061c-el6-x86_64-bundle.tar
8、安裝Percona-Server
解壓完成后,我們可以開始安裝Percona-Server。使用以下命令安裝Percona-Server的必要組件:
sudo rpm -ivh Percona-Server-shared-56-5.6.31-rel77.0.el6.x86_64.rpm
sudo rpm -ivh Percona-Server-client-56-5.6.31-rel77.0.el6.x86_64.rpm
sudo rpm -ivh Percona-Server-server-56-5.6.31-rel77.0.el6.x86_64.rpm
9、啟動mysql服務
安裝完成后,我們需要啟動mysql服務以使其正常運行:
sudo service mysql start
10、修改root密碼
默認情況下,Percona-Server的root用戶沒有密碼。我們需要使用以下命令來修改root密碼:
mysqladmin -u root password "newpassword"
11、設置遠程訪問
如果需要遠程訪問Percona-Server,則需要為root用戶添加遠程訪問權限??梢允褂靡韵旅钸M行設置:
mysql> grant all privileges on *.* to 'root'@'%' identified by 'password';
mysql> flush privileges;
12、打開3306端口防火墻
默認情況下,3306端口是關閉的。如果需要從遠程訪問Percona-Server,則需要在防火墻中打開這個端口??梢允褂靡韵旅钸M行設置:
sudo /sbin/iptables -I INPUT -p tcp --dport 3306 -j ACCEPT;
sudo /etc/rc.d/init.d/iptables save;
sudo /etc/init.d/iptables status;
13、使用客戶端遠程連接
現在,您可以使用Percona-Server的客戶端工具連接到數據庫了。可以使用mysql命令進行連接:
mysql -u root -p
14、總結
本文介紹了如何安裝和部署Percona-Server,其中包括下載Percona-Server、上傳至CentOS、安裝cmake、創(chuàng)建mysql-percona目錄、拷貝Percona-Server-5.6.31-77.0-r5c1061c-el6-x86_64-bundle.tar到mysql-percona、解壓Percona-Server、安裝Percona-Server、啟動mysql服務、修改root密碼、設置遠程訪問、打開3306端口防火墻、使用客戶端遠程連接等步驟。